Bid this to game or slam
fourdad replied to dickiegera's topic in Intermediate and Advanced Bridge Discussion
We had a thread a while back where which minor to open was discussed. At the time, I said it depends on whether you are strong enough to reverse. This hand is an example of that and is why it should open 1D. After the sequence....1D-1S-2S-P-3C-P-?, N now knows that partner has a minimum opener because he did NOT reverse. N counts his pd as minimum (13) and values his hand as 17. Adds to game and under the "one who knows goes" tenet, N bids 5C. If S has 15 he bids 6C. else pass. Bippity boppity BOO!! :rolleyes: -
Would you bid at unfav?
fourdad replied to andrei's topic in Intermediate and Advanced Bridge Discussion
It depends on if your agreement is to play 2NT and/or Michaels as preemptive or showing a hand. This hand is too strong for a preemptive 2NT, hence 1H. -
